Step 8: The very last step of the cleaning process is to leave the fuel tank … Web20 aug. 2012 · I has a 4-cycle gas powered 8.75 Hp B&S engine on my power washer. I haven't used it in the last 2 years. Today, when I went to fill up the gas tank I noticed that the old gas has evaporated and deposited what looks like gas varnish. After filling up the tank with new FRESH gasoline the engine would not kick-over and start.

Web5 aug. 2007 · He recommends: run it almost out of fuel, fill the tank with 5 gals of MINERAL SPIRITS, driving it through as completely as possible, fill up tank with fresh diesel, and enjoy the like-new performance. If not, do it one more time. He says he's done it for years. Also says he's never lost an injection pump in nearly 20 years of dieseling. Web2 jun. 2024 · Has anyone had good luck cleaning old gas varnish from a model A tank. I have a 29 gas tank to clean that sat 30 tears with about 5 gallons of skanky gas in it. The bottom and sides are covered with a dark sticky varnish that keeps stopping the gas flow. Web26 okt. 2024 · Rust can be removed from inside a gas tank by following the steps given below: Filling (or almost filling) the tank with vinegar and baking soda is the safest way of chemical rust removal. Allow the mixture to settle until it bubbles and the rust flakes begin to change color. Then give it a good rinse to make sure it’s entirely empty.
